Visitor Restrictions
To protect our patients and caregivers during this flu season visitation is limited to:
- Two visitors per patient at a time
- Visitors age 18 or older only
We recommend visitors wash their hands with soap and water or sanitizer before and after their visit. In addition, visitors should refrain from visiting if they feel ill, have a fever or are experiencing respiratory symptoms.
We understand the value of visitation for our patients and seek to balance their desire to see family and friends with need to reduce the spread of flu. We appreciate your cooperation.
